How to convert Ground to Cent

To convert ground to cent, multiply the number of ground by the conversion factor 5.509642, because 1 ground = 5.509642 cent. The conversion is linear, so the same factor works for any value — whole numbers, decimals or fractions. For the reverse direction, 1 cent = 0.1815 ground, so you divide by 5.509642 (or multiply by 0.1815) to turn cent back into ground.

cent = ground × 5.509642  ·  ground = cent × 0.1815

What is a Ground? History, origin and usage

The ground is a South Indian land unit conventionally taken as 2,400 square feet. It is a traditional local measure whose detailed origins are not well documented, and it is gradually being phased out since metrication.

It is best known in Tamil Nadu, and especially in Chennai property listings, where plot and house sizes are frequently quoted in grounds. Despite the spread of the square foot, it remains common in everyday real-estate parlance in the region.

One ground is about 2,400 square feet, or roughly 223 square metres, close to a 40-by-60-foot plot. A little under 18.2 grounds make one acre.

What is a Cent? History, origin and usage

The cent takes its name from the Latin centum, meaning one hundred, because it is one-hundredth of an acre. It is the southern Indian counterpart of the eastern Indian decimal, a survival of the British practice of splitting the acre into a hundred equal parts.

It is the common small-plot unit in South India, used in Tamil Nadu, Kerala, Karnataka, Andhra Pradesh and Telangana for real-estate deals and government allocations. Despite metrication it persists in news reports and property listings across the south.

One hundred cents make one acre, and a cent is about 435.6 square feet or roughly 40.5 square metres. A cent and a decimal are the same area under two regional names.
